代码改变世界

JQuery AJAX 加载 HTML代码“&lt”形式的。怎么解析成"<"形式,并且把"<img>"解析成图片输出到浏览器中。

2011-06-01 17:53  沐海  阅读(2631)  评论(0编辑  收藏  举报

声明:此方法目前用火狐通过验证。IE未能通过。

 

前台 写法:   <div  style="visibility:hidden"  id="Change"></div>  元素要是1.可以写入HTML代码的容器(input不行) 2.要是不可见的(利用CSS实现)

JQuery AJAX 加载 HTML代码“&lt”形式的。怎么解析成"<"形式,并且把"<img>"解析成图片输出到浏览器中。

   for (var rowNum = 0; rowNum < data.rows.length; rowNum++) {
                var Id = data.rows[rowNum].cell[0];
                var title = data.rows[rowNum].cell[1];
                var creatDateTime = data.rows[rowNum].cell[2];
                var creatDate = creatDateTime.substr(0, creatDateTime.lastIndexOf(" "));
                if (title.length > 5) {
                    title = title.substr(0, 5) + "...";
                }
                var Contents =data.rows[rowNum].cell[3];
              var kk= jQuery("#Change").html(Contents).text();
            
                var ViewNum = data.rows[rowNum].cell[4];
                var Photo = data.rows[rowNum].cell[5];
                var $li = "";
                //                alert(phpto);
                $li += "<tr><td class='fl_icn' style='width: 60px;'><a href=' target='_blank'><img src='" + Photo + "' alt=''align='left' height ='80px' width ='80px'/> </a></td>";
                $li += "<td tyle='width: 20%;' align ='center'><h2><a href' target='_blank'>" + title + "</a><em class='xw0 xi1' title=" + title + "> </em></h2></td>";
                $li += " <td tyle='width: 20%;'align ='center'><p class='xg2'><div>" + kk + "……</div></p></td></tr>";
                jQuery("#" + container + "").append($li);
                jQuery("#Change").html();
            }
记录生活、工作、学习点滴!
E-Mail:mahaisong@hotmail.com 欢迎大家讨论。
沐海博客园,我有一颗,卓越的心!